What is the overall point of the "Set Instance Name" option? It seems overkill for what it's worth. #623
-
I use Everything, and Everything Toolbar religiously. They are an essential bit of kit that I can't live without. However, once in a while when I have to reinstall things, I am forced to have to reference the documentation to know what to set the instance name to when I use Everything 1.5 Beta. In my opinion, why is it not just a radio selection, or a context menu option in lieu of having to set the instance name? The contact menu "Set Instance Name" should be replace with "What version of Everything do you use?" with submenu choices of "Everything 1.4" and "Everything 1.5 Beta". To me, this would be much simpler on the end user side, and would have the end user have to reference documentation each time it's setup with the Beta version. I'm not sure if there is extended use of "Set Instance Name", but at this time, I can't find any other use for it, other than to specify use of the beta. 🤷♂️ Am I missing something here? |

Named instances is a feature of Everything: https://www.voidtools.com/support/everything/multiple_instances/#named_instances Supporting them was a feature request from a long time ago. Unfortunately, Everything 1.5 alpha requires setting a different instance name, which I agree can be a bit confusing during setup. That’s just one of the quirks of using an alpha version. I expect the stable release of Everything 1.5 will not require this change anymore, so an option to select the 1.5a instance might break something in the future. |
